  • Total timing for 2 poweradders??

    351 making 350NA hp, adding small centrifical at 6#'s of boost, and a wet Zex 125 shot. What do you think about total timing? I currently run 24º with the 125 shot. I was thinking maybe 18º??

      • #4
        I don't know how much timing you should take out for the boost, but in addition to whatever that is, the general rule of thumb is 2 degrees of timing for every 50 hp on nitrous. So for a 125 shot, pull 4.5 degrees of timing out.

          • #6
            Originally posted by Diabolic View Post
            Why not share it?
            What he's getting at is that he, among others, have 'taken their lumps' and 'figured it out' on thier own - aka blown shit up, headgaskets etc..and that's how he makes his living.


            What's said above isn't a bad idea. I'd start near the 16* mark, and bring it up a little at a time - keeping a close eye on plugs and A/F.

            I would definitely ensure that you're A/F is in check on both the nitrous (before blower install) and the blower seperately. If you have one or both of them lean out, you can scatter it in a hurry, or have a hard ass time finding the real problem.
